In An Impressive Turnaround Of The Usual Patterns Of Planned Cities, Abuja, The Capital Of Nigeria, Emerges As An Extraordinary Example Of Success In Civil Engineering And Construction. This City, Conceived In The 1970s As A New Capital For The Country, Not Only Was Successfully Built But Also Thrived, Attracting Millions To Its Urban Core.

Abuja, A City That Defied Common Expectations Of Mega Construction Projects, Is A Rare Success Story Among Planned Cities And Civil Engineering. While Many Of These Initiatives Are Remembered For Their Disastrous Outcomes, Abuja Stands Out As A Notable Exception.

Originally, Lagos, The Former Capital Of Nigeria, Was An Expanding Metropolis With Around 24 Million Inhabitants. However, It Faced Severe Issues Such As Wealth Inequality, Lack Of Permanent Housing For Many Of Its Residents, Poor Sanitation Conditions And The Threat Of Rising Sea Levels. These Challenges, Along With The Legacy Of Colonialism And The Need For A More Central And Accessible Capital, Led To The Decision To Build Abuja.

How Was The Construction Of Abuja?

The Planning And Construction Process Of Abuja Was Meticulous And Gradual, Following An Approach Different From Typical Planned Cities. The City Was Developed In Phases, With A Constant Concern To Address The Real Needs Of The Population, Rather Than Simply Creating An Urban Structure Without A Defined Purpose. This Strategy Of Natural Growth Ensured That Abuja Did Not Suffer The Same Fate As Many Other Planned Cities That Remained Empty Or Underutilized.

Despite Initial Challenges, Including Political And Economic Issues, The Construction Of Abuja Gained Momentum Under The Military Administration Of Muhammadu Buhari. Significant Investments In Infrastructure, Such As Water, Telecommunications, And Energy, Enabled The City To Support A Million Inhabitants. The Subsequent Population Boom Accelerated Development Even Further, With The Construction Of Schools, Hospitals, And New Residential Districts.

Today, Abuja Is Not Only The Political Center Of Nigeria, But Also A Growing Cultural And Economic Hub.

With An Estimated Population Of 1.7 Million In The City And About 6 Million In The Metropolitan Area, Abuja Is The Seventh Largest City In Nigeria. The City Houses Significant Government Buildings, Financial Institutions, And Serves As A Focal Point For Tourism, Culture, And Religion.

However, The Story Of Abuja Is Not Without Criticism And Problems. Social And Economic Inequalities Persist, And Marginalized Areas Face Sanitation Problems And Access To Basic Services. The City Still Needs To Address Issues Of Equity And Sustainability To Continue Its Path To Success.

Nonetheless, Abuja Stands Out As A Notable Example Of Success In Civil Engineering And The Construction Of A Planned City. Its Existence And Prosperity Challenge The Notion That Planned Cities Are Fated To Fail, Showing That, With Careful Planning And Responding To Real Needs, Such Projects Can Not Only Succeed But Also Become Vital For The Growth And Development Of A Nation.
